The annual Ed Yurek Memorial Euchre Tournament, hosted by Yurek Pharmacy & Home Healthcare, is returning on Friday, November 8th at 7 p.m. at the St. Thomas Seniors’ Centre.
The tournament is a charity event, with all proceeds going to Valora Place- Formerly Violence Against Women Services Elgin County.
“The annual Ed Yurek Memorial Euchre Tournament is a lovely moment to come together with laughter, friendly competition, and an opportunity to meet new folks while ensuring support for families who have experienced abuse in their pursuit of safer lives,” boasts Liz Brown, Executive Director of Valora Place.
“When we were growing up, spending quality time with family and friends meant playing a game of Euchre,” says Peter Yurek, co-owner of Yurek Pharmacy. “My dad, Ed, loved Euchre and supporting local causes. We are proudly continuing the tradition.”
He adds that “everyone who came out had an absolute blast. There’s a cash bar, lots of prizes, and I think Jim”, the winner of last year’s tournament, “is coming back to defend his title.”
Tickets can be purchased for $25 a person at Yurek Pharmacy (519 Talbot Street, St. Thomas), or at the St. Thomas Seniors’ Recreation Centre (225 Chestnut Street, St. Thomas).
